New York State Police, New York
End of Watch Friday, January 15, 1932
Add to My HeroesTheophilius Gaines
Corporal Theopolis Gaines and Lieutenant Tremain Hughes were killed when their state police airplane crashed a few miles east of Cazenovia in Madison County, New York, at 5:19 pm.
Corporal Gaines was conducting routine inspections of Troop Communications Sections and was being transported from Troop to Troop by aircraft. Corporal Gaines was a passenger in a plane operated by Lieutenant Hughes, and it is believed that they hit the top of a tree during a forced landing in foggy conditions. The aircraft burst into flames, and both were killed.
Lieutenant Hughes was trapped in the rear cockpit of the burning plane, and Corporal Gaines was thrown from the plane and died instantly.
Corporal Gaines had served New York State Police in Albany and had previously served with Troop B Malone. In 1928, he had been shot in the shoulder and jaw while chasing a suspected bootlegger. He was survived by his wife, parents, and brother.
